| /** |
| * Returns an Observable that emits the results of invoking a specified selector on items |
| * emitted by a ConnectableObservable that shares a single subscription to the underlying stream. |
| * |
| * ![](multicast.png) |
| * |
| * @param {Function|Subject} subjectOrSubjectFactory - Factory function to create an intermediate subject through |
| * which the source sequence's elements will be multicast to the selector function |
| * or Subject to push source elements into. |
| * @param {Function} [selector] - Optional selector function that can use the multicasted source stream |
| * as many times as needed, without causing multiple subscriptions to the source stream. |
| * Subscribers to the given source will receive all notifications of the source from the |
| * time of the subscription forward. |
| * @return {Observable} An Observable that emits the results of invoking the selector |
| * on the items emitted by a `ConnectableObservable` that shares a single subscription to |
| * the underlying stream. |
| * @method multicast |
| * @owner Observable |
| */ |
